énumération DRM_LICENSE_STATE_CATEGORY (Wmdrmsdk.h)
Le type d’énumération DRM_LICENSE_STATE_CATEGORY spécifie le type de restriction de licence décrit par une structure de DRM_LICENSE_STATE_DATA .
Syntaxe
typedef enum DRM_LICENSE_STATE_CATEGORY {
WM_DRM_LICENSE_STATE_NORIGHT = 0,
WM_DRM_LICENSE_STATE_UNLIM,
WM_DRM_LICENSE_STATE_COUNT,
WM_DRM_LICENSE_STATE_FROM,
WM_DRM_LICENSE_STATE_UNTIL,
WM_DRM_LICENSE_STATE_FROM_UNTIL,
WM_DRM_LICENSE_STATE_COUNT_FROM,
WM_DRM_LICENSE_STATE_COUNT_UNTIL,
WM_DRM_LICENSE_STATE_COUNT_FROM_UNTIL,
WM_DRM_LICENSE_STATE_EXPIRATION_AFTER_FIRSTUSE
} DRM_LICENSE_STATE_CATEGORY;
Constantes
-
WM_DRM_LICENSE_STATE_NORIGHT
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u n’est pas autorisée.
-
WM_DRM_LICENSE_STATE_UNLIM
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ée sans restriction.
-
WM_DRM_LICENSE_STATE_COUNT
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ée, mais uniquement un nombre défini de fois.
-
WM_DRM_LICENSE_STATE_FROM
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ée après une date définie.
-
WM_DRM_LICENSE_STATE_UNTIL
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ée jusqu’à une date définie.
-
WM_DRM_LICENSE_STATE_FROM_UNTIL
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ée entre deux dates définies.
-
WM_DRM_LICENSE_STATE_COUNT_FROM
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ée, mais uniquement un nombre défini de fois après une date définie.
-
WM_DRM_LICENSE_STATE_COUNT_UNTIL
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ée, mais uniquement un nombre défini de fois jusqu’à une date définie.
-
WM_DRM_LICENSE_STATE_COUNT_FROM_UNTIL
-
Spécifie que l’action pour laquelle le DRM_LICENSE_STATE_DATA a été reçu est autorisée, mais uniquement un nombre défini de fois entre deux dates définies.
-
WM_DRM_LICENSE_STATE_EXPIRATION_AFTER_FIRSTUSE
-
Spécifie que l’action pour laquelle l’DRM_LICENSE_STATE_DATA a été reçue est autorisée pendant une durée définie à compter de la première utilisation de l’action.
Notes
Aucun.
Spécifications
Condition requise | Valeur |
---|---|
En-tête |
|